Snowballs

Melt-in-your-mouth cookies, also known as Russian Tea Cakes, that are buttery, crumbly, and dusted with powdered sugar—a holiday classic perfect for sharing.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 27 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: Dessert, Snack
Cuisine: Holiday, Russian
Calories: 100

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ar Additional powdered sugar for dusting (optional, but recommended!)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up chopped nuts (walnuts or pecans) Feel free to substitute the nuts based on preference or dietary restrictions.

Method
 

Preparation and Baking
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or keep it ungreased.
  2. In a large bowl, cream the softened butter and powdered sugar together until light and fluffy.
  3. Mix in the vanilla extract for that sweet, aromatic flavor.
  4. In another bowl, whisk together the flour and salt. Gradually add this mixture to the butter mixture, stirring well until combined.
  5. Stir in the chopped nuts, giving your cookies a delicious crunch.
  6. Shape the dough into small balls, about 1 inch in diameter, and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
  7.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the bottoms turn a light golden color.
  8. Remove them from the oven, allow them to cool slightly, and then roll them in powdered sugar.
  9. Place them on a wire rack to cool completely, and dust them with powdered sugar again for an extra touch.

Notes

Store Snowballs in an airtight container at room temperature for about a week. For longer storage, freeze them for up to three months.
